Can you chew your food too much?

I keep reading "Chew everything really well!" and things to that nature. Can you ever "overchew" your food to the point that it goes through the band too fast?

My doctor has said to be sure to not over chew. In essence, don't turn your good solid food into slider food. It never made since to me to chew tiny bits of food to mush either, so I was really glad when he clarified that for me. I'd rather have a little looser band so that I can eat pretty normally. I really don't think if anyone was interested enough in watching me eat, they'd think I was eating any differently than anyone else.

I use small plate because my meal portions are small, but I've never used baby utensils. Pre-banding, if I got a bite of tough meat, I could swallow and let my stomach take care of the digestion, but you're not going to get away with that after banding. I would never take a huge bite of steak, for instance, but I'd say I cut off maybe nickel size bites and chew well, but not to a liquidy mush.

That question also came up at our lap band support group meetings, so it's one a lot of people wonder about. That surgeon in attendance also said to be to not over chew, because if you do, you're not taking advantage of the band's restriction.

YES YOU CAN! Just saw my doc today and I was told that if you over chew the food goes down to fast like slider food. He saw aim for a cottag cheese consistancy and this makes the stomach work better.
